Definition of Stop over

1. Verb. Interrupt a journey temporarily, e.g., overnight. "We had to stop over in Venezuela on our flight back from Brazil"

Exact synonyms: Lay Over
Generic synonyms: Stop
Derivative terms: Layover, Stopover

2. Verb. Interrupt a trip. "They stopped for three days in Florence"
Exact synonyms: Stop
Generic synonyms: Break Up, Cut Off, Disrupt, Interrupt
Specialized synonyms: Call, Lay Over
Derivative terms: Stop, Stop
